Artist: Caspian
Song: "Halls of the Summer"
Album: Waking Season
"'Halls of the Summer' came together after I bought a sampling machine and started to digitally manipulate instruments like vocals, mellotrons, pianos and flutes," guitarist Philip Jamieson explains to Rolling Stone. "Balancing these new sounds with the familiarity of what we do naturally as a band felt powerful, bridging the gap between the intimacy of textured instrumentation and the full-on attack of a rock band guided us through the creation of this piece."
